About Union Assistant Chief Engineer

  Overview

  Position Summary Details

  ABM, a leading provider of integrated facility solutions, is looking for an Assistant Engineer.

  The Assistant Engineer provides assistance with various maintenance projects including operating, maintaining, and inspecting facility equipment in accordance with written, posted and industry standards. Performs regular inspections and reports findings with recommendations to management.

  Essential Functions

  Provides management for engineering staff at the direction of the Chief Engineer.

  Performs and administers the necessary preventive maintenance and operations work orders as well as provides applicable quality assurance inspections. Reports and collaborates with Chief Engineer on status and findings. Recommends improvements to the program and implements as directed.

  Provides hands-on and classroom training for engineering staff and promotes an environment of learning and development.

  Provides and manages stock levels on all engineering equipment and parts.

  Schedule all activities of the Stationary Engineers and inspects work performed and materials used. Evaluates all work orders and assess priorities and distribute them to responsible staff for action, monitor progress, and adjust resources to accommodate emergency maintenance requests.

  Reviews incomplete work orders and informs requestor of schedule changes. Provide regular reports to the Chief Engineer regarding any scheduled work delayed for parts, emergencies, or other reasons.

  Schedule engineers for regular workdays, holidays, and vacation relief.

  Prepares labor and material purchase requisitions and distributes for approval.

  Maintain self-improvement program and keep abreast of new equipment, standards, codes, maintenance procedures and emergency response regarding hazardous materials.

  Responsibilities

  Experience that is commensurate with the specific facility for the position of Assistant Chief Engineer. Prefer 3+ years progressive operations experience.

  Strong employee relation skills, coaching skills and training skills.

  As required, highest-level relevant state/local license for stationary engineer and/or HVAC, plus universal level refrigerant recovery license.

  BOMA accredited courses desirable.

  Preferred: High-rise Fire Safety Director, Haz-Mat Certification, Indoor Air Quality Certification, LEED Certification.

  Strong oral and written communication skills.

  Ability to work with MS Word, Excel, and Outlook.

  Computer skills and building automation systems experience required.

  Certification meeting OSHA ACM awareness training requirements as required.

  Working knowledge of energy conservation required, formal training preferred.
